- [ ] Step 7: Archive cold storage buckets (Glacierline tier). Confirm both ceremony witnesses are present, verify bucket manifests match the Oxbow ledger, then seal the archive key shares. Plugin authors may observe but not handle shares. Once sealed, the archive index itself is encrypted and can only be reopened with the passphrase below.

vault phrase of badup-hahig = tamael-aldael-kelmir-istael-fenok-istwyn-tamius-jorath-oliion

TileForge cache layer: when customers report blurry or missing map tiles, it's almost always a cold cache after a region redeploy. Warm it with the preheat job before escalating. If tiles are still stale after an hour, flush the edge layer and rerun. In your ticket reply, paste the trace token that appears just below.

build token for kagaf-hahof: htk14_9d3d4d26d7d8de

TICKET-2087: Thumbcache token expired

The Pixelhold image cache worker is leaking memory (~300MB/hr) and auto-restarts now fail because its credential for the internal purge service expired. Restarts without a valid token skip the purge step, compounding the leak. Fix the leak later; unblock restarts now. Rotate on the usual 90-day cycle going forward. Apply the replacement key below to the worker config.

service key, fawip-bajef: kto11_Qt5wZK9vdNC

Subject: Key rotation for the dedupe pipeline

Future maintainers: as part of quarterly rotation, the credential used by the Merletide customer-record deduplication job to reach our internal MatchForge service has been replaced. The old key stops working at month end. Update the job's secrets entry and rerun the smoke dedupe on staging before the next batch. The replacement MatchForge key appears below.

gateway credential: kto3_qfe

Runbook: session-token refresh bug in Driftlane auth. Affected clients loop on refresh when the token clock skews past 30 seconds. Mitigation: restart the refresh service with skew tolerance raised to 90 seconds. The service validates its config against the signing keystore at startup, so append the keystore secret on the following line.

vault entry, yahif-yajep: COURIER_KEY29=b802bdf8034096b65a51c6ba5abe2